Career
He began his writing career working for Jim Henson's Muppets. During his tenure at The Muppets, he was visually caricatured as the puppet "Chip" (The Jim Henson Hour). In 1991, Prady was nominated for an Emmy award for co-writing the posthumous tribute to Jim Henson entitled "The Muppets Celebrate Jim Henson."
He wrote the Disney theme park attractions Muppet*Vision 3D and Honey, I Shrunk the Audience.
He is currently the executive producer and co-creator of the CBS sitcom The Big Bang Theory.
